Border Security Force (BSF) troops successfully intercepted and shot down a Pakistani drone that was attempting to transport narcotics along the international border in Amritsar, Punjab. The incident took place on Monday, and during the subsequent search operation, two packets believed to contain heroin were seized by the BSF. This is not the first instance of such a seizure by the BSF. On May 21 and before, BSF had managed to shoot down another Pakistani drone carrying narcotics near the International Border in Amritsar.
